Who's Right?
Evan and Justin preview their small groups’ new study in Romans after finishing Joshua, Judges, and Ruth, noting they’ll move quickly through this theology-heavy letter in about 13 weeks. They set the context: Paul likely writes from Corinth to believers spread across Rome, a diverse and influential city, and he thanks God that their faith is proclaimed worldwide. In Romans 1, they highlight Paul’s longing to visit, his eagerness to preach, and his confidence that the gospel is God’s power for salvation to Jews and Gentiles, urging believers not to remember the power of the Gospel. They discuss Paul’s teaching on God’s wrath, humanity’s rejection of truth seen in creation, the dangers of relativizing truth, and the moral chaos that follows when God “gives them over,” concluding that the ultimate solution for a depraved world is the transforming power of the gospel.
